Vanessa says to write about the things that frustrate you, in a breathless flash, and I think of all the times things haven't been accessible, when I've struggled to read museum signs or restaurant menus, when i've struggled with tiny font on websites, or filling out the form at the pharmacy, when banks forget the large font for my letters, or when Moorfields do it once and never again, and I realise my frustrations wont fit into this drabble, and they will go unheard, but I have to say them somewhere, for I can't keep them in my throat forever.
